But there’s also a special piece of merchandise you can grab ONLY if you’re attending the event, and we’re telling you how to find it!

You can grab a Mickey’s Not-So-Scary Halloween Party 50th Anniversary Lithograph (essentially a fun little collectible poster) at this year’s event! The lithograph was being handed out to guests as they exited the party so be sure to look for them on your way out!

So Cool!

The lithograph features Mickey, Minnie, and Pluto on their way to the Castle, which is fully decorated for the 50th Anniversary. But it looks like some happy haunts have taken residence in the Most Magical Place on Earth! You’ll also spot a Mickey pumpkin wreath (interestingly these are featured on the poster but have NOT appeared in the park yet), and the Cinderella carriage wreath.

Another Look at This Poster

Keep in mind that this poster was being handed out during the first night of Mickey’s Not-So-Scary Halloween Party (the party we attended), but things are always subject to change. The distribution site, time, or even the availability of this poster could be different in the future; and it’s possible that if Disney runs out of these, they may not be available at future parties. Just be sure to see what’s going on during the party you attend.
